political parties protests in j-k civilians casualties in poonch
Political parties in Jammu and Kashmir organized protests on Saturday, calling for an unbiased investigation into the deaths of three civilians allegedly detained by the Army in the Poonch area for questioning.
The deceased individuals, namely Safeer Hussain (43), Mohammad Showket (27), and Shabir Ahmad (32), were among eight individuals picked up by the Army in connection with Thursday’s attack. In response to the incident, the Jammu and Kashmir administration announced compensation and job opportunities for the families of the three civilians found dead near the site of an anti-militancy operation in the Poonch district.
Mehbooba Mufti, the president of the Peoples Democratic Party (PDP), asserted that the Army had taken 15 individuals for questioning, resulting in three fatalities and others sustaining serious injuries.
“Following the Poonch incident, 15 people from Topa Peer village were picked up by the Army for questioning. Bodies of three individuals, showing signs of injury, were discovered near the encounter site, while the remaining 12 are admitted to various hospitals in critical condition,” Mehbooba stated during a press conference at the party headquarters on Saturday. The former chief minister of Jammu and Kashmir demanded a compensation of Rs 50 lakh each for the families of the deceased and Rs 5 lakh each for the injured until a thorough inquiry is conducted.
She also mentioned a video circulating online purportedly showing Army personnel mistreating some suspects. “I observed a video depicting Armymen assaulting people and applying red chili powder on their wounds. While it is a distressing video, I cannot vouch for its authenticity,” Mehbooba added.
Activists of the Apni Party, led by their Kashmir provincial president Ashraf Mir, staged protests at the party headquarters, expressing their dismay over the civilian deaths. The National Conference (NC) also protested the same issue, urging authorities to “halt the bloodshed of innocents.”
“NC has consistently condemned terrorism. We deplore the killing of five soldiers. However, we also denounce the killing of innocent civilians. If the government has initiated an NIA inquiry into the killing of soldiers, a similar investigation should be launched into the killing of civilians,” stated the party’s general secretary, Ali Mohammad Sagar.
Meanwhile, senior CPI(M) leader Mohammad Yusuf Tarigami called for a swift and impartial inquiry into the mysterious deaths of the three individuals. “Demanding a fair probe into the ‘mysterious’ death of three civilians near the encounter spot in Poonch. A prompt and impartial probe is crucial to ascertain the cause of their death,” Tarigami emphasized in a post.
He also unequivocally condemned the militant attack in which five soldiers made the ultimate sacrifice in the line of duty, extending his deep condolences to their families.
